Abstract
A compact ultra-wideband (UWB) monopole rectangular microstrip patch antenna with high gain is designed, simulated and analyzed. The proposed antenna having a very compact dimension of 24 mm × 35 mm × 1.6 mm is compatible and highly suitable for compact wireless systems and any UWB application. The proposed antenna exhibits -10 dB impedance bandwidth of 12 GHz (3 GHz-15 GHz) with multiple operating frequencies at 3.5 GHz, 6 GHz, 10.6 GHz and 13 GHz. A peak antenna gain of 4.7 dBi is achieved. VSWR of the proposed antenna is in between 1 and 2 in the entire operating band with low cross polarization with stable radiation pattern. The proposed antenna is simulated by using CST Microwave Studio software. Keywords - Microstrip Patch Antenna, Ultra-wideband, Compact, High Gain
